Are solar panels microgrids?

No, solar panels are not microgrids. Solar panels are a type of renewable energy technology that can be used to generate electricity. Microgrids are a type of electrical grid that can use renewable energy technologies, such as solar panels, to generate and distribute electricity.

How do microgrids work?

Microgrids work in the same way as the national grid, just without nuclear power stations and pylons blotting the landscape. A microgrid generates energy using renewable sources, usually solar panels. It stores that energy in battery banks for when it’s needed.

What happens if a microgrid goes down?

Microgrids can provide power to important facilities and communities using their distributed generation assets when the main grid goes down. Because electrical grids are run near critical capacity, a seemingly innocuous problem in a small part of the system can lead to a domino effect that takes down an entire electrical grid .
